#9b100f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b100f is composed of 60.8% red, 6.3%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.7% magenta, 90.3%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 0.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 33.3%. #9b100f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ff201e with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#9b100f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b100f has RGB values of R:155, G:16,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.9,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10162191.

Shades and Tints of #9b100f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0101 is the darkest color, while #fef9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b100f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5050 is the less saturated color, while #a80302 is the most saturated one.
